淘宝(阿里百川)手机客户端开发日记第一篇 android 主框架搭建(四)
我们上一级,完成了主要的布局部分,这一节我们对上一节的bug做处理。
首先,我们再res/drawable下建立三个样式表
<?xml version="1.0" encoding="utf-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<!-- 选中时的效果-->
<item android:drawable="@drawable/menu_index_icon_s" android:state_selected="true"/>
<!-- 未选中时的效果 -->
<item android:drawable="@drawable/menu_index_icon"/>
</selector>
我们来修改下MainActivity.java下的部分代码:
private int imageArray[] = { R.drawable.menu_index_icon,R.drawable.menu_category_icon, R.drawable.menu_my_icon};
private int imagePressedArray[] = { R.drawable.menu_index_icon_s,R.drawable.menu_category_icon_s, R.drawable.menu_my_icon_s};
我们现在只需要样式的文件,这两个数组主要用来是设定图片的,现在我们不需要这2个数组了,现在将其替换为样式的文件。
private int imageArray[] = { R.drawable.tab_home_btn,R.drawable.tab_category_btn, R.drawable.tab_my_btn};
现在我们重新运行:
OK!
转载请注明http://www.cnblogs.com/yushengbo,否则将追究版权责任!
更多相关文章
- android客户端从服务器端获取json数据并解析的实现代码
- 爱奇艺Android客户端软件开发实战(全套)
- 博客园Android客户端V3.0
- 用.Net打造一个移动客户端(Android/IOS)的服务端框架NHM(四)——Andr
- 乐博Android客户端(新浪微博)1.01发布,欢迎各位童鞋试用
- Android客户端应用享用传统Web服务
- Android贝壳单词客户端应用源码
- Django服务器与App(Android)客户端的简单实现
- 开发规范:《阿里巴巴Android开发手册》之初理解